    About the Government of Brunei Scholarship

    The Government of Brunei Darussalam Scholarship for Foreign Students is administered by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and offers opportunities to study at five prestigious institutions in Brunei: Universiti Brunei Darussalam (UBD), Universiti Islam Sultan Sharif Ali (UNISSA), Universiti Teknologi Brunei (UTB), Kolej Universiti Perguruan Ugama Seri Begawan (KUPU SB), and Politeknik Brunei (PB).

    Benefits of the Government of Brunei Scholarship 2026

    • Full Tuition Coverage: Complete exemption from tuition, examination, registration, and orientation fees.
    • Monthly Personal Allowance: BND 500 per month for personal expenses.
    • Meal Allowance: BND 150 per month for food costs.
    • Book Allowance: BND 600 per year for textbooks and study materials.
    • Accommodation: Free housing at university residential colleges.
    • Travel: Economy class round-trip airfare to and from Brunei.
    • Baggage Allowance: BND 250 (ASEAN) or BND 500 (outside ASEAN) for shipping personal effects.
    • Insurance: Comprehensive health insurance coverage throughout the scholarship period.

    Eligibility Criteria for the Government of Brunei Scholarship 2026

    • Open to citizens of all countries, with priority given to ASEAN, Commonwealth, and OIC member countries.
    • Maximum 25 years old for Diploma and Undergraduate programs; Maximum 35 years old for Masters programs (as of July 1 of the year the program starts).
    • Applicants must have good academic records in their previous qualifications.
    • Brunei citizens, permanent residents, and students who have previously studied in Brunei are not eligible.
    • The scholarship cannot be held concurrently with any other scholarship without prior approval.

    Required Documents for the Government of Brunei Scholarship

    • Completed online application form
    • Certified copies of passport and/or birth certificate
    • Certified copies of academic qualifications and transcripts
    • English translations of documents not in English
    • English proficiency certificate (if applicable)
    • Employment certificate (if applicable)
    • Reference letters from referees
    • Research proposal (for research-based programs only)

    Application Timeline for the Government of Brunei Scholarship 2026

    • December 15, 2025: Applications open
    • February 15, 2026: Application deadline
    • March – May 2026: Interviews may be conducted
    • July/August 2026: Academic year begins

    How to Apply for the Government of Brunei Scholarship 2026

    1. Visit the official Ministry of Foreign Affairs scholarship page.
    2. Click on the BDGS application link and enter your email to receive an OTP.
    3. Complete the online application form with accurate information.
    4. Upload all required documents in PDF, JPG, or Word format (max 10MB).
    5. For UBD applicants, also complete the UBD admission portal application.
    6. Submit before the February 15, 2026 deadline.

    FAQs About the Government of Brunei Scholarship 2026

    Is IELTS required for the Brunei scholarship?

    IELTS is not mandatory. English proficiency may be assessed through an interview or written examination depending on the program.

    Can I bring my family to Brunei?

    Scholarship recipients are not encouraged to bring family members during the scholarship period.
